Output 5d7f5150d780b042a91aa0ceca6c1238d9aae7ce3258f6caa5378f46b6a3d20c:1

value
172065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ef957420b4effd25d6689cf84b7f69b0da95eda8 OP_EQUAL
address
3PXpTcPu6mSSa9ETWt9MDPbNbFzHLLaD3U
transaction
5d7f5150d780b042a91aa0ceca6c1238d9aae7ce3258f6caa5378f46b6a3d20c
confirmations
302573
spent
true